Masa A. Shimazoe, D4 student and JSPS Special Researcher in Genome Dynamics Laboratory(Maeshima Laboratory), received the “Poster Prize: 1st Place” at the “EMBL Conference: Gene regulation: one molecule at a time” held in EMBL Heidelberg, Germany, on July 15th – 18th. In addition, he also received the “EMBL Advanced Training Centre Corporate Partnership Programme fellowship”.
SOKENDAI Student Dispatch Program supported this trip.
▶ Awarded presentation title: Linker histone H1 functions as a liquid-like glue to organize chromatin in living human cells
